Web design and development is the process of creating a website that not only looks appealing but also functions smoothly across devices and platforms. It brings together visual design, user experience planning, front-end coding, and back-end integration to create a complete digital product.
What Does the Process Involve?
It typically begins with a discovery phase, where business goals, user needs, content requirements, and functionality are defined. Based on this, designers create mockups and wireframes using tools like Figma or Adobe XD to visualize the layout, navigation, and overall look and feel.
Once the design is approved, the development phase starts. Front-end development focuses on building the parts users interact with, using languages like H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and frameworks such as React or Vue.js. Back-end development supports the behind-the-scenes infrastructure, often using PHP, Node.js, or Python, depending on the platform and functionality required.
Many websites are built on content management systems (CMS) like WordPress, Webflow, or Shopify, allowing easier content updates without needing direct code access. E-commerce platforms may also integrate with tools like WooCommerce or Shopify's backend, while performance optimization is handled through techniques like image compression, lazy loading, and CDN integration.
Before launch, testing is carried out across browsers and devices to ensure functionality, responsiveness, and loading speed. After deployment, regular maintenance ensures the site stays updated, secure, and aligned with any new business needs.
Tools Commonly Used
- Design: Figma, Adobe XD, Sketch
- Front-End: HTML, CSS, JavaScript, React, Vue
- Back-End: Node.js, PHP, Python
- CMS: WordPress, Webflow, Shopify
- Performance & QA: Lighthouse, GTmetrix, Google Search Console
